Item 3.02 Unregistered Sales of Equity Securities.

 

On December 3, 2019, KULR Technology Group, Inc. (the “Company”) accepted subscription agreements (“Subscription Agreements”) for a final closing of a private placement offering (the “Offering”) with certain accredited investors, pursuant to which it sold an additional 3.33 shares of Series C Convertible Preferred Stock (“Series C Preferred Stock”), having an aggregate stated value of $33,300, and warrants to purchase 8,325 shares of common stock, par value $0.0001 per share (“Common Stock”), for aggregate gross proceeds to the Company equal to $30,000.

 

Under the Offering, the Company sold a total of 24.01 shares of Series C Preferred Stock, having an aggregated stated value of $240,100, and warrants to purchase 60,025 shares of Common Stock for aggregate gross proceeds to the Company equal to $216,000. The Company will use the net proceeds from this Offering for general corporate purposes.

 

Each warrant issued under the Offering has an exercise price of $1.50 per share of Common Stock and expires two years after the date of the warrant’s issuance (the “Warrants”). Each share of Series C Preferred Stock is senior in liquidation preferences to the Common Stock, and holders of shares of Series C Preferred Stock are entitled to receive dividends at an annual rate of twelve percent (12%) beginning one year after each share’s issuance. The foregoing description of the Series C Preferred Stock is not complete and is qualified by reference to the full text of the Certificate of Designation of Series C Convertible Preferred Stock, which is incorporated by reference to Exhibit 4.1 to the Current Report on Form 8-K filed August 23, 2019.

 

The offer and sale of the securities were made in reliance on an exemption from registration under Section 4(a)(2) of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”).

 

The foregoing description of the Subscription Agreements and Warrants are not complete and are q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of the Form of Subscription Agreement and Form of Warrant, copies of which are filed as Exhibit 10.1 and 10.2, respectively, to this Current Report and is incorporated by reference herein.

3. ADJUSTMENTS OF EXERCISE PRICE, NUMBER AND TYPE OF WARRANT SHARES

 

(a)           The Exercise Price and the number of shares purchasable upon the exercise of this Warrant shall be subject to adjustment from time to time upon the occurrence of certain events described in this Section 3.

 

(i)            Subdivision or Combination of Stock. In case the Company shall at any time subdivide (whether by way of stock dividend, stock split or otherwise) its outstanding shares of Common Stock into a greater number of shares, the Exercise Price in effect immediately prior to such subdivision shall be proportionately reduced and the number of Warrant Shares shall be proportionately increased, and conversely, in case the outstanding shares of Common Stock of the Company shall be combined (whether by way of stock combination, reverse stock split or otherwise) into a smaller number of shares, the Exercise Price in effect immediately prior to such combination shall be proportionately increased and the number of Warrant Shares shall be proportionately decreased. The Exercise Price and the Warrant Shares, as so adjusted, shall be readjusted in the same manner upon the happening of any successive event or events described in this Section 3(a)(i).
